I really wonder how he's gonna look like next to the other new Bretonnians. If you were to put the new plastic knights next to the new resin ones you'll find that they were very clearly designed by different people with different visions. The plastic foot knights of the realm are very tall, very skinny and very busy, with small heads and massive weapons - the resin paladins, who were very clearly designed to be much more in line with the old Bretonnia esthetic, look plain and squat in comparison. On first glance, this guy looks like he might blend better into the knights of the realm than the other foot characters - he even has the lock-and-key thing hanging from his belt that became a design choice for the foot knights of the realm for some reason. Personally, I'm much more of a fan of Bretonnia's resin over plastic releases so far and was hoping GW was going to stick to that esthetic going forward.
